Living in Sunnyside Gardens
Sunnyside Gardens is a historic planned community within Sunnyside, built in the 1920s on English garden-city principles and now a designated New York City historic district. Its blocks of low brick row houses share landscaped interior courtyards and communal green space, and residents have access to the private Sunnyside Gardens Park. The 7 train along Queens Boulevard, with 46th and 52nd Street stations nearby, connects the area to Midtown in about 15 minutes.
Because of its landmark status, exteriors and courtyards are carefully preserved, giving the district a rare, low-density, tree-lined feel for New York City. Homes here are tightly held and rarely come to market, prized by buyers looking for something architecturally distinctive and quiet within an easy commute of Manhattan.
